To create a Paragraph text, press the mouse and drag it to draw a rectangle, then release the mouse.
To create a Point text, choose a Type tool and click (press and release) the mouse at some place, which will become the origin.

Normally, you can do a drawing with an optional aspect ratio, but by checking “Fixed aspect ratio” on the top of the screen, you can draw a square.Īnd by selecting “Circle”, you can draw a circle in whatever shape you want.īy again fixing the aspect ratio, you can draw a perfect circle.īy using the selection tool, you can draw a shape of just the outline.Īfter selecting the tool, check “Fixed aspect ratio”, and select a random spot.įrom the “Selected area” tab, choose “Selected boundary drawing”.Ĭhoose an optional number (for the thickness of the outline), uncheck “Round corners, and maintain the line thickness”, and when you click “OK”,you will have a drawing of just the outline of a square.Īt the same time, by selecting “Ellipse”, you can draw a perfect circle.
